         <title>Module 2: 2.1 Planning your museum visit</title>
         <author>vicencio_anamargarida</author>
         <link>https://padlet.com/vicencio_anamargarida/or61upz42q69/wish/250431016</link>
         <description><![CDATA[<div>Hello!</div><div>Most museums are very wide and diverse contexts for learning so it is important to reduce the "novelty" effect. Otherwise the students will feel a bit lost and probably it will be difficult for them to focus on the activities (and learning) related with the main learning goals for the visit to the museum. So, it is very important that the main goals of the visit are explicit to the students and that they know from the very begginning what king of assignments they are supposed to develop from that visit. It is also important that they can get to know something about the museum that they are about to visit: what kind of museum it is? What are the mais themes explored in the museum collections? How is the space at the museum organized? It is essencial that all the security rules and schedules are also explicit to everyone.</div><div>There are a lot of ways to prepare our students for the visit and the activities that they will develop. We can just tell all about this in an oral presentation, give them a resume (written information) but if we could we should try a more Inquiry apporoach. We can divede our studets in small groups (3 or 4 students/group) and challenge them to research information about the museum, come up with a research-question or problem and plan an investigation that they can carry on at the museum. They can also get started from a problem or resarch-question and reseach what museum could help them with their inquiry. Either way, it is very important that students feel that they will learn something new at the museum. It will be a fieldtrip not a saunter.</div><div>amvicencio (Portugal)</div>]]></description>

         <title>Module 2: 2.2 During your museum visit</title>
         <author>vicencio_anamargarida</author>
         <link>https://padlet.com/vicencio_anamargarida/or61upz42q69/wish/250436162</link>
         <description><![CDATA[<div>If you are engaged in an inquiry approach probably your students are visiting the museum to investigate something. So, let them draw their investigation: collect data about the collection and some specific objects, discuss ideias, making hypothesis, investigate further more when they get back to school. Collecting data can be very challeging: they can take pictures, they can interview museum specialists or even other visitors about their perceptions, they can draw objetcs or compare the objects they know from other contexts with the ones displayed at the museum. At the end it is very important to gather everyone around and make sure that the main ideias (key concepts) are explicit to all students so, before getting out of the museum, the teacher and docent (museum educator) should promote a discussion with all the students and make a roundup of all the learning goals developed at the museum.<br>amvicencio/Vicencio (Portugal)</div>]]></description>
